In the North America market for Positive Temperature Coefficient (PTC) thermistors, several types dominate the landscape. Ceramic PTC thermistors hold a significant share, primarily due to their robustness and versatility in various applications such as automotive electronics and industrial equipment. These thermistors offer stable performance across a wide temperature range, making them ideal for temperature sensing and overcurrent protection.

Polymer PTC thermistors, another major segment, are valued for their self-regulating properties, which find extensive use in consumer electronics and heating applications. Their flexibility and low-cost manufacturing contribute to their popularity in the region. Silicon PTC thermistors are gaining traction, particularly in high-precision applications like medical devices and telecommunications, owing to their precise temperature coefficients and reliability. Composite PTC thermistors, combining different materials for enhanced performance characteristics, are increasingly being adopted in niche applications requiring specific thermal conductivity and resistivity profiles. Other types of PTC thermistors cater to specialized needs in sectors like aerospace and renewable energy, highlighting a diverse and evolving market landscape across North America.

1. What are PTC thermistors?

PTC thermistors are a type of thermistor that exhibits a positive temperature coefficient, meaning their resistance increases as temperature rises.

2. What are the key applications of PTC thermistors?

PTC thermistors are commonly used in overcurrent protection, motor starting, and self-regulating heating elements.

10. What are the regulatory standards governing the production and use of PTC thermistors?

Regulatory standards such as IEC 60738 and UL 1434 govern the production and use of PTC thermistors, ensuring their safety and performance.

12. How do PTC thermistors compare to NTC (negative temperature coefficient) thermistors?

Unlike NTC thermistors, PTC thermistors exhibit increasing resistance with temperature, making them suitable for specific applications such as self-regulating heaters and overcurrent protection.
